TAIR AT1G50240.2 Protein kinase family protein with ARM repeat domain. The FUSED (FU) gene belongs to Ser/Thr protein kinase family and has a key role in the hedgehog signaling pathway known to control cell proliferation and patterning in fruit flies and humans . Arabidopsis thaliana genome has a single Fu gene. Cytokinesis-defective mutants, which we named two-in-one (tio), result from mutations in Arabidopsis Fu. Phenotypic analysis of tio mutants reveals an essential role for TIO in conventional modes of cytokinesis in plant meristems and during male gametogenesis. TIO is tightly localized to the midline of the nascent phragmoplast and remains associated with the expanding phragmoplast ring. This gene was previously annotated as two gene models, AT1G50230.1 and AT1G50240.1, however the experimental evidence exists (Oh et al, Current Biology, 2005) showing that these two models are in fact single gene, named FUSED. 0
